Угловой 6,7 Как применить цвет темы по умолчанию к mat-sidenav фоне?

Введите все строки сразу:

writer.writerows(A)

вместо

writer.writerow(A)

Файл newfile.csv теперь выглядит следующим образом:

Max,3, M
bob,5,M
jane,6,F

Кроме того, добавьте () в свою последнюю строку, это вызов функции: result.close().

Если вы находитесь на Python 2.6 или новее, вы можете использовать эту форму:

import csv
A = (('Max', 3, 'M'),('bob', 5, 'M'),('jane', 6, 'F'))
with open('newfile.csv', 'wb') as result:
    writer = csv.writer(result, dialect='excel')
    writer.writerows(A)
0
задан Prajwal 18 January 2019 в 06:52
поделиться

1 ответ

Вам потребуется применить пользовательскую тему к вашему компоненту. Подведем итог:

  1. Определите вашу тему в style.scss
  2. Определите тему компонента , напр. my-component.component.scss-theme.scss. Это может отличаться от my-component.component.scss. Вы можете выделить темы (цвет и типографика) в файле темы и другие вещи (размеры, положение и т. Д.) В файле, не относящемся к теме.
  3. Включить и вызвать компонентную тему в style.scss

Я создал образец приложения на Stackblitz . Как вы видите, mat-sidenav и mat-toolbar имеют одну и ту же тему. Вы можете попробовать, дав color=primary|accent|warn - mat-toolbar и mat-sidenav

Томас Траян написал очень хороший средний блог на Полное руководство по темам угловых материалов ]. Вы можете найти документ команды Angular на . Тематизировать ваши собственные компоненты .

0
ответ дан shhdharmen 18 January 2019 в 06:52
поделиться